Qmail Auditor, auditoria no servidor Qmail

Se você também não quer recompilar seu Qmail com o patch do Qmailtap, este artigo é a solução para o seu problema. Resolvi escrevê-lo porque o software está sem continuidade e não compila corretamente nas versões mais recentes da glibc.

[ Hits: 14.264 ]

Por: Walter de Souza Neto em 18/11/2009


Colocando pra funcionar



O programa qmail-auditor instalado no seu sistema funciona como um wrapper para o qmail-queue, para isso você deve renomear o seu arquivo qmail-queue, que normalmente fica em /var/qmail/bin para qmail-queue-real-auditor. Se você usa um programa alternativo como qmail-queue-scanner.pl, como no meu caso, é este que deverá ser renomeado. E logo em seguida criar um link apontando para o qmail-auditor. Seguem os comandos:

# mv /var/qmail/bin/qmail-queue-scanner.pl /var/qmail/bin/qmail-queue-real-auditor
# ln -s /usr/local/bin/qmail-auditor /var/qmail/bin/qmail-queue-scanner.pl


Pronto! Já está tudo pronto para usar, a configuração é bem simples, basta criar um arquivo chamado "auditor" no diretório control (normalmente em /var/qmail/control/auditor) e criar as linhas para auditoria com a seguinte sintaxe.

Para copiar as mensagens verificando o remetente:

from <email regex> <email que vai receber a copia>

Para copiar as mensagens verificando o destinatário:

to <email regex> <email que vai receber a copia>

Para copiar as mensagens verificando ambos:

all <email regex> <email que vai receber a copia>

Exemplo para pegar todos os email do domínio xurupita e mandar para o email Ronaldo:

from .*@xurupita.com.br ronaldo@xurupita.com.br
to .*@xurupita.com.br ronaldo@xurupita.com.br

ou apenas:
all .*@xurupita.com.br ronaldo@xurupita.com.br

Quero encerrar este artigo primeiramente pedindo desculpas a comunidade por ter ficado por quase 10 anos utilizando software livre e começar a compartilhar minhas experiências só depois de muito tempo. Espero que este artigo seja o primeiro a ser publicado depois de muitos que só ficaram na idéia e nunca "pularam" para o "papel".

Espero ter ajudado quem passou pelo mesmo problema que eu, qualquer dúvida estou disponível para ajudar através do e-mail cadastrado no meu perfil aqui no VOL.

"O temor do SENHOR é o princípio do conhecimento; os loucos desprezam a sabedoria e a instrução." Provérbios 1.7

Página anterior    

Páginas do artigo
   1. Introdução
   2. Colocando pra funcionar
Outros artigos deste autor
Nenhum artigo encontrado.
Leitura recomendada

Dividindo carga de saída de servidor SMTP (MTA Selor)

Instalação e configuração do sendmail

Conversão da base de dados do Cyrus IMAP no Debian

Como fazer usuário interagir com SpamAssassin

Instalando e configurando o IceWarp Mail Server

  
Comentários
[1] Comentário enviado por ticobebedouro em 18/11/2009 - 09:24h

Netinho, parabéns pelo artigo cara. Se todas suas contribuições forem assim então vale a pena a demora. Muito bom mesmo.

[2] Comentário enviado por wsouzajr em 20/11/2009 - 20:28h

Este é o meu garoto. Parabéns pelo artigo e clareza nas informações. É um prazer ver que você já está muito, mas muito mesmo além do que te ensinei. Pai.

[3] Comentário enviado por grandmaster em 23/11/2009 - 00:14h

Bom artigo. Ta guardado

---
Renato de Castro Henriques
CobiT Foundation 4.1 Certified ID: 90391725
http://www.renato.henriques.nom.br


Contribuir com comentário




Patrocínio

Site hospedado pelo provedor RedeHost.
Linux banner

Destaques

Artigos

Dicas

Tópicos

Top 10 do mês

Scripts